Hello everyone,

Does anyone know if any work written within a few decades of Thomas Aquinas's lifetime mentions the story about him at the banquet table of Louis IX? I know the story is mentioned (without a written source, one of those "dicitur" situations) in a 17th-century work, but I agree with Jacques LeGoff in his big book on Louis IX that this isn't sufficient evidence to accept its authenticity.
